Key ceremony checklist — Matchforge GC pauses

[ ] Item 7: Verify the pause-mitigation config before sealing keys. Matchforge's matching service hits 400ms+ GC pauses under load; the tuned heap flags live in the ceremony vault alongside the signing keys. Confirm flags match the runbook in the Dunmore wiki, then reseal. Future maintainers: if the vault is sealed when you arrive, do not regenerate keys. Unseal it with the recovery passphrase below.

unlock words, yagep-fahof: belix-rusvan-casdor-gorox-aldath-norael-istix-quenael-fraeth-silael

Audit item 22: Garagepulse occupancy feed readiness. Confirm the feed publishes valid counts for all six Harrowdale garages, stale-data alerts fire within 90 seconds, and the fallback cache serves last-known values during outages. Verify the schema version matches the release notes. Release manager should not approve until the checks above carry the signature of the feed owner.

named custodian: Oliath Ralax

## Alert: StatRelay Sidecar Flush Lag

This alert fires when the StatRelay metrics-aggregation sidecar falls more than 120 seconds behind on flushing buffered samples to the Coalmine backend. Plugin-emitted counters are buffered in-process, so sustained lag usually means a plugin is emitting unbounded label cardinality or blocking the flush thread. Check your plugin's metric registration against the published cardinality limits before escalating. If the lag persists after your plugin is ruled out, contact the telemetry team.

escalation mailbox, bagug-fahof: novdor.wendor.jormir@norvalabs.example